Pomegranate Powder: Your New Juicing Bestie

Pomegranate powder is a fantastic way to enjoy the health benefits and delicious taste of pomegranates without the hassle of peeling those tricky arils. It’s essentially dried pomegranate juice or fruit, ground into a fine powder. This makes it incredibly versatile and easy to incorporate into your favorite drinks, smoothies, and even snacks. Think of it as concentrated sunshine in a jar, ready to brighten up your day!

Why Choose Pomegranate Powder?

Pomegranates are packed with nutrients and antioxidants, like punicalagins and anthocyanins, which are known for their health-promoting properties. These little powerhouses can help fight inflammation, support heart health, and boost your immune system. Using the powder means you get these benefits in a convenient, shelf-stable form.

  • Convenience: No more messy seeds or sticky fingers. Just scoop and mix!
  • Shelf-Life: Unlike fresh juice, the powder lasts a long time when stored properly.
  • Versatility: Use it in juices, smoothies, yogurt, oatmeal, and more.
  • Nutrient-Dense: A concentrated source of pomegranate’s beneficial compounds.

The Big Question: How Much Pomegranate Powder for Your Juice?

This is where it gets exciting! Finding the right amount of pomegranate powder for your juice is all about balancing flavor and desired health benefits. For a standard 10 oz (about 300 ml) glass of juice, a good starting point is usually 1 to 2 tablespoons of pomegranate powder.

However, this is just a guideline. The “perfect” amount can depend on a few things:

  • Your Taste Preference: Do you like a strong, tart pomegranate flavor, or a more subtle hint?
  • The Powder’s Concentration: Different brands and types of pomegranate powder can vary in intensity.
  • What You’re Mixing It With: If you’re adding it to a blend of other fruits and vegetables, you might need more or less to make the pomegranate flavor stand out.

The best approach is to start with a smaller amount (like 1 tablespoon) and gradually add more until you achieve the taste you love. It’s always easier to add more than to take it away!

Getting the Perfect Pomegranate Juice: A Step-by-Step Guide

Let’s make some delicious pomegranate juice with powder. It’s super simple!

  1. Gather Your Ingredients: You’ll need your pomegranate powder, water (or your base liquid), and any other fruits or veggies you’d like to add.
  2. Measure Your Powder: Start with 1 to 2 tablespoons of pomegranate powder for a 10 oz serving.
  3. Choose Your Liquid: Filtered water is great, but you can also use coconut water, almond milk, or even a splash of citrus juice.
  4. Mix Thoroughly: In a glass or shaker bottle, add the pomegranate powder and a small amount of your liquid. Stir or shake well to create a smooth paste. This helps prevent clumping.
  5. Add Remaining Liquid: Pour in the rest of your liquid (about 10 oz total) and mix or shake again until everything is fully combined.
  6. Taste and Adjust: Take a sip! Does it need more pomegranate flavor? Add another teaspoon of powder. Too tart? Add a touch of natural sweetener like honey or stevia, or mix with a sweeter fruit juice.
  7. Enjoy! Drink immediately for the freshest taste and best nutrient absorption.

Tips for Mixing Pomegranate Powder

To ensure your pomegranate powder blends smoothly and tastes great, here are a few handy tips:

  • Start with a Paste: Always mix the powder with a small amount of liquid first to create a smooth paste. This is the secret to avoiding clumps.
  • Use a Shaker Bottle: A shaker bottle with a whisk ball is perfect for getting a super smooth mix.
  • Blend in Smoothies: If you’re making a smoothie, toss the powder in with your other ingredients. The blender will handle any potential clumping.
  • Consider the Flavor Profile: Pomegranate has a tart, slightly sweet flavor. It pairs wonderfully with berries, apples, citrus fruits, and even leafy greens like spinach.
  • Don’t Overheat: If you’re adding it to warm drinks, do so after the liquid has cooled slightly. High heat can degrade some of the beneficial compounds.

Common Pomegranate Powder Recipes for Beginners

Here are a few simple ways to use pomegranate powder that are perfect for beginners:

1. Simple Pomegranate Refresher

Ingredients:

  • 1.5 tablespoons pomegranate powder
  • 10 oz filtered water
  • Optional: Squeeze of lemon or lime, a touch of honey or stevia

Instructions: Mix powder and a little water into a paste, then add remaining water and stir well. Adjust sweetness/tartness as desired.

2. Berry-Pomegranate Smoothie Boost

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up mixed berries (frozen or fresh)
  • 1/2 banana
  • 1 tablespoon pomegranate powder
  • 1 cup almond milk or water
  • Optional: A few spinach leaves

Instructions: Combine all ingredients in a blender and blend until smooth. Easy peasy!

3. Pomegranate Oatmeal Topper

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up cooked oatmeal
  • 1 teaspoon pomegranate powder
  • Optional: Nuts, seeds, or a drizzle of maple syrup

Instructions: Sprinkle the pomegranate powder over your prepared oatmeal and mix in gently. Adds a beautiful color and a tangy twist!

Understanding Pomegranate Powder Quality and Sourcing

Not all pomegranate powders are created equal. To get the most benefits and the best taste, look for these qualities:

  • Pure Pomegranate: Ensure the ingredient list contains only dried pomegranate or pomegranate extract. Avoid powders with added sugars, fillers, or artificial ingredients.
  • Source: Reputable brands often provide information about where their pomegranates are grown.
  • Processing: Look for powders made using methods like freeze-drying or low-heat drying, which help preserve nutrients. For example, freeze-drying is a common method used to retain the nutritional integrity of fruits and vegetables, as detailed by the USDA Agricultural Research Service.
  • Color: A good quality powder should have a rich, deep pink or red color.

How to Store Pomegranate Powder

Proper storage is key to keeping your pomegranate powder fresh and potent:

  • Airtight Container: Always store the powder in its original packaging if it’s resealable, or transfer it to an airtight glass jar or container.
  • Cool, Dry Place: Keep it away from heat, light, and moisture. A pantry or cupboard is ideal.
  • Avoid Refrigeration (Usually): Unless the packaging specifically recommends it, refrigeration can introduce moisture, which can cause clumping.

When stored correctly, pomegranate powder can last for a year or even longer!

Frequently Asked Questions About Pomegranate Powder

Q1: How much pomegranate powder is safe to consume daily?

A1: For most adults, consuming 1-3 tablespoons of pomegranate powder daily as part of a balanced diet is generally considered safe and beneficial. However, it’s always a good idea to start with a smaller amount and see how your body reacts. If you have specific health conditions or are on medication, consult with your healthcare provider.

Q2: Can I use pomegranate powder in hot beverages like tea?

A2: Yes, you can! However, to preserve the maximum amount of beneficial nutrients, it’s best to add the powder to your tea after it has cooled slightly, rather than pouring boiling water directly over it. Warm, not hot, is the way to go.

Q3: Does pomegranate powder taste the same as fresh pomegranate juice?

A3: It’s very similar! Pomegranate powder offers a concentrated, tart, and slightly sweet flavor that closely mimics fresh pomegranate juice. The intensity might vary slightly between brands, but the characteristic taste is definitely there.

Q4: How do I avoid clumps when mixing pomegranate powder?

A4: The best trick is to mix the powder with a small amount of liquid first to create a smooth paste before adding the rest of your liquid. Using a shaker bottle with a whisk ball also helps ensure a smooth, clump-free consistency.

Q5: Can I substitute pomegranate powder for fresh pomegranate arils in recipes?

A5: You can substitute it for the juice aspect, but not directly for the arils if a recipe calls for their texture. For instance, you can add pomegranate powder to smoothies or drinks where juice is implied, but you wouldn’t sprinkle it on a salad in place of arils.

Q6: Is pomegranate powder good for weight management?

A6: Pomegranate powder, being a good source of antioxidants and fiber (if the whole fruit is used in its making), can be a healthy addition to a weight management plan. It can help you feel full and provides nutrients without a lot of calories. However, it’s just one part of a healthy diet and lifestyle.

Q7: What are the main health benefits of pomegranate powder?

A7: Pomegranate powder is rich in antioxidants, particularly punicalagins and anthocyanins, which are known to help reduce inflammation, support heart health by improving blood flow and lowering blood pressure, and boost the immune system. It’s also a source of Vitamin C.
